The iron sight is a open, unmagnified system used to assist the aiming of a variety of devices, usually those intended to launch projectiles, typically firearms. Several weapons, such as the M7, utilizes an iron sight, however other UNSC weapons, e.g. the Assault Rifle, the Machine Gun Turret, and the M6 Handguns do not seem to use them for reasons unknown.
